Description:
The Neurosurgery Surgical Frazier Suction Tube – Angled, 12 French (Fr), Working Length 6″, is engineered for high-performance suction control in neurosurgical, spinal, and ENT procedures. With a large 12Fr lumen, this instrument offers exceptional flow capacity, making it ideal for removing larger fluid volumes efficiently while maintaining precise control. The angled shaft design ensures superior reach into deep surgical cavities, providing optimal maneuverability under operating microscopes.
Constructed from high-grade surgical stainless steel, the instrument combines rigidity with refined handling. The integrated finger vent allows real-time suction regulation, supporting both micro and macro-level dissection control. Each Frazier suction is meticulously polished to a mirror finish for easy cleaning, reliable sterilization, and enhanced visibility during critical microsurgical moments.
